Hello, I've recently acquired some BattleZone components for repair and restoration and one of such components is the super cool "MathBox" Aux board used for 3D vector and sound processing within the BattleZone arcade system. When I acquired this board, it was missing all 4 2901 Bit-Slicers, as well as all BPROMs (the Bit-Slicer microcode roms as well as the microcode mapping ROM), the POKEY chip, and had a broken Quad 2-Ch AND gate IC in need of replacement as well. I've managed to buy replacements for all components except for a few of these BPROMs so far, and I was wondering if I could get help on what resources are available for sourcing the ROM files for these particular chips (I'm not sure if they're under the same scrutiny as other ROMs considering it's for ALU microcode and not for game content itself). If it needs to be through physical BPROM sale from a fellow collector then so-be-it, but I have an Andromeda Research Laboratories EPROM+ programmer w/ BPROM adapter coming in the mail alongside Phillips/Signetics-compatible BPROMs for this Aux board and I would like to be able to handle my own programming if possible. The BPROMs I currently have access to is:
- 36176
- 36178

Which means I'm missing:
- 36175
- 36177
- 36179
- 36180

I see there's also a public GitHub available with all of the original sourcecode to Battle Zone, including the V05 source file used to compile the individual SAV files to be loaded onto individual BPROMs. I have managed to find what are supposedly the original Atari Development Toolset online as well, which I imagine should possibly be able to compile and link the V05 file alongside the associated COM and MAC files as well, but I've never used it before and wouldn't be surprised if it fails simply due to age and compatibility quirks.
